Fuzhou is a beautiful city with a rich history and stunning natural scenery, making it a fantastic destination for seniors. Here’s a friendly and relaxed 6-day itinerary that balances sightseeing, cultural experiences, and leisure time. Let’s dive in!
## Day 1: Arrival and Relaxation
Morning:
- Arrive in Fuzhou and check into your hotel. Choose a comfortable hotel with good amenities, perhaps near the city center for easy access to attractions.
Afternoon:
- After settling in, take a leisurely stroll around West Lake Park. The park is serene, with beautiful gardens and walking paths. It’s a great place to unwind after your journey.
Evening:
- Enjoy a welcome dinner at a local restaurant. Try some Fuzhou specialties like Buddha Jumps Over the Wall (a rich soup) or Fuzhou Fish Balls.
## Day 2: Cultural Exploration
Morning:
- Visit the Fuzhou National Forest Park. It’s a lovely place for a gentle hike or a stroll. The fresh air and beautiful scenery will be refreshing!
Afternoon:
- Head to the Three Lanes and Seven Alleys (Sanfang Qixiang), a historical area with ancient architecture. You can explore the narrow lanes, visit small shops, and enjoy some local snacks.
Evening:
- Have dinner in the area, perhaps at a restaurant that offers a view of the ancient buildings lit up at night.
## Day 3: Historical Sites
Morning:
- Visit the Fuzhou Confucius Temple. It’s a peaceful place with beautiful architecture and gardens. Take your time to soak in the history and tranquility.
Afternoon:
- Explore the Xichan Temple, known for its stunning architecture and serene atmosphere. It’s a great spot for some quiet reflection.
Evening:
- Enjoy a traditional tea ceremony at a local tea house. It’s a lovely way to experience Chinese culture and relax.
## Day 4: Nature and Relaxation
Morning:
- Take a day trip to Guling Mountain. You can enjoy the scenic views and perhaps have a picnic lunch. There are gentle walking paths suitable for seniors.
Afternoon:
- Visit the Fuzhou Hot Springs for a relaxing soak. It’s a perfect way to unwind and rejuvenate.
Evening:
- Return to Fuzhou and have a casual dinner at a local eatery.
## Day 5: Local Markets and Crafts
Morning:
- Visit the Fuzhou Folk Custom Museum to learn about local crafts and traditions. It’s a great way to appreciate the local culture.
Afternoon:
- Explore the Wuyi Square area, where you can visit local markets. It’s a fun place to shop for souvenirs and try street food.
Evening:
- Have dinner at a restaurant that specializes in local cuisine. Don’t forget to try some Fuzhou rice noodles!
## Day 6: Leisure and Departure
Morning:
- Spend your last morning at Nanhou Street, a charming area with shops and cafes. Enjoy a leisurely breakfast and do some last-minute shopping.
Afternoon:
- Depending on your flight time, you might have a chance to visit the Fuzhou Museum to learn more about the city’s history.
Evening:
- Head to the airport for your departure, taking with you wonderful memories of Fuzhou!
Tips for a Senior-Friendly Trip:
- Pace Yourself: Make sure to take breaks and stay hydrated.
- Transportation: Consider using taxis or ride-sharing apps for convenience.
- Comfortable Footwear: Wear comfortable shoes for walking.
- Local Assistance: Don’t hesitate to ask locals for help or directions; they are usually very friendly!
